Ballinger, Texas - Giant Cross

100 feet tall, 70 feet wide, 50 tons. [Russ Baker, 05/18/2005]

[RA: Ballinger's inspired the creation of a larger cross in Groom, Texas. The Ballinger cross was built in 1993 by the Studer Family. It is illuminated at night, and is adjacent to a grotto of Our Lady of Guadalupe.]
